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
425555625 9965825293 39 383418450 81561141
57340406635 44630110924 9643856840
57340406635 44630110924 9643856840
8456 157 191
All about undefined
Interested in learning more?
57340406635 44630110924 9643856840
8456 157 191
See more
49072 8264716811
04360424125 21875927 7029416664 438746 976
See more
00911 60811242
29480 79423020 4389 85
See more